She's back!!





Drove her back home with no issues! 4x4 system works perfectly but was only tested then de-activated because the tyres are different sizes and would kill it under normal use.

The engine is evil, if you think that fitting an XE flywheel makes the V6 rev... make up some tubular manifolds!!!

Full spec:

1995 Calibra Turbo 4x4 chassis (facelift)
Full turbo 4x4 running gear inc. F28 6-speed gearbox
Uprated clutch consisting on F28 friction plate, 20XE pressure plate and 20XE flywheel
Ex-police Omega 3.0 M-V6 24v engine - top end fully rebuilt with new belt and rollers
Tubular steel exhaust manifolds, modified C25XE downpipes (to clear TXB) - heat wrapped (double wrapped when passing TXB) all the way to the lamda sensor
2.5" exhaust system made from: Standard C20LET CAT and midbox (all 2.5" bore), Longlife backbox and duplex tailpipes all heavily modded to sit into rear bumper (sounds deep and beefy but not loud)
Lowered 60mm front, 70mm rear on spax springs and adjustable shockers, rear camber adjusted to match front camber (so the TXB won't die)
Everything else is standard

I have driven a few standard 4x4 Turbos before and wasn't impressed with their off-boost drive-ability, the V6 really makes this car easy and drive at all revs and speeds.
